One of the most effective ways to secure a job before graduation is through internships and sandwich placements. Employers heavily favor graduates who already possess hands-on industry experience. The University of Bradford maintains robust partnerships with regional, national, and international organizations, giving students exclusive access to competitive placement roles.
Whether your field is engineering, health studies, management, or computer science, undertaking a placement year allows you to apply theoretical knowledge to real-world business challenges. It also frequently results in graduate job offers before your final year even begins.

Employers across finance, healthcare, marketing, and software development expect fresh graduates to possess baseline digital fluency and AI literacy.
Bradford incorporates digital skills modules across various courses, but students should also take the initiative to upskill independently. Understanding how to leverage AI tools for data analysis, project management, and content creation will give you a massive competitive edge.
| Skill Category | Why It Matters in 2026 | Where to Learn at Bradford |
|---|---|---|
| AI Prompt Engineering | Enhances workflow efficiency and data handling | Library Digital Skills Workshops |
| Data Visualization | Translates complex metrics into actionable insights | Faculty Computing Labs |
| Agile Project Management | Core requirement for modern corporate teams | School of Management Modules |
